Output ddfae8647823a768ae9893e9a6f2f8b5b65b533c6008f5d05b390fcac1083887:0

value
7780000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7d8a407443dd8292bfff4bcb7fd188a9238e5a OP_EQUALVERIFY OP_CHECKSIG
address
1DdGe9aaTDREuvgcWsqgdWnEJf5te2hAhP
transaction
ddfae8647823a768ae9893e9a6f2f8b5b65b533c6008f5d05b390fcac1083887
spent
true